Family | FABACEAE |
Genus species | Astragalus sedaensis Y.C.Ho sect. Oroboidei |
Habitat | grassland |
Altitude | 4100-4300m |
Description | leaves 5-7cm long, leaflets 8-11 pairs, elliptic to oblong, adaxially glabrous, abaxially white hirsute, flowers numerous in dense raceme, corolla ca. 12mm long |
Size | 10-15cm |
Color | yellow |
Bloom | summer |
Ca | |
Type | tuft, fl. stem ascending |
Cultivation | mesic, slightly humous, sunny site alpine house, moist, rich, drained soil, sun |
Propagation | scarified seed in spring, germ. 1-3 months, 10-13°C cuttings in late summer |
